    I onboarded with Kareo/ Tebra an electronic health record/ billing platform. The process is for them to submit paperwork correctly to the insurance companies to allow the Tebra to electronically submit billing claims to the insurance company. Tebra incorrectly labeled me as having a group NPI (national provider identification). Myself and my ****** went back and forth for 8+ months and longer with tebra support and the insurance company. It discovered after aprox $4500 in lost revenue due to timing out Tebra coded me wrong group NPI vs an individual NPI that caused the issue. I also bought other Tebra partner products Patient pop that started billing hidden fees text message fee for a service I never used. I did pay for a complete 1 year subscription of this patient pop advertising ($4800). I noticed that the new referrals from this product stopped once I contested this ($84) charge. They messaged me daily saying it was overdue. I called paid the hidden $84 charge and immediately started receiving new referrals. This is extremely shady business that I can no longer tolerate. I put a request in on 4/1/24 to end my patient pop account and cancel my ********************** EHR services. As compensation they awarded me $47 because of the lost $4500 revenue because of their mistake.

    Decemeber 2023: Met w/ Tebra sales rep and he reviewed the use of the two platforms; an electronic health records system and reputation management system, both cloud based.End of Dec 23: I signed a 1-year contract based on the sales calls and started onboarding to the platform. Jan 2024: Was informed a non-cloud based software would need to be downloaded to each computer that needed to use the billing functions. Informed Tebra staff this would not work for our clinic and we needed to discuss our contract as this was not within the product presentation. Jan-Feb 2024: Spoke with sales and customer loyalty to present the concerns. Feb 14: Was presented with an offer to pay $8,768 of the contract. I asked the offer be adjusted based on the misrepresentation. Sent multiple emails asking sales to confirm with customer loyalty that the misrepresentation had in fact taken place. Feb 23: Sent a counter offer for $1,096 and asked for the account to be closed immediately. Sent multiple emails to customer loyalty requesting update or response. No response. March 14: Received response from customer loyalty stating they were accepting my counter offer. Was informed that because an invoice for the month of march was created, I would also have to pay an additional $1,351.98. Informed customer loyalty that I had requested account to be terminated upon my offer on Feb 23rd. Customer loyalty rep stated that he would not help me any further and I would pay the money or be sent to collections. March 19: I have sent multiple emails describing the timeline and need for correction regarding the invoiced amount and received no response. I will pay the agreed upon early termination fee, but I made my counter offer prior to the invoiced date and should not be held financially responsible for their slow response. Additionally, customer loyalty was continually rude and stating, "you aren't going to get away with paying nothing", which was not what I was trying to do.
